This Chocolate Raspberry Mug Cake is a quick, decadent dessert that combines the richness of chocolate with the tartness of fresh raspberries. Perfect for satisfying your sweet tooth in just a few minutes, this mug cake is made in the microwave for a single-serving treat that’s warm, gooey, and absolutely indulgent.

Ingredients
- 1/4 cup flour all-purpose, 32 grams
- 1 1/2 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1/4 teaspoon baking powder
- 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
- 1/4 cup low-fat buttermilk 60 ml
- 2 tablespoons melted butter salted
- 2 tablespoons raspberry preserves
- whipped cream for garnish
- fresh raspberries for garnish
Instructions
-
In a medium sized b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a powder, baking powder and sugar. Mix in buttermilk, melted butter and raspberry preserves. Stir until there are no lumps.
-
Pour the batter into two small coffee or tea cups that are microwave safe.
-
Microwave the cups for about 60 to 90 seconds on high or until batter rises and cakes are cooked.
-
Let the cups cool for a few minute before serving. Cakes will deflate while they are cooling.
-
Garnish with whipped cream and raspberries. Enjoy!

Tips & Variations:
- Frozen Raspberries: If you’re using frozen raspberries, ensure they’re thawed and drained of excess moisture to avoid a soggy cake.
- Sweetness Adjustments: You can adjust the sweetness based on your preference by using more or less sugar. You could also try a sugar substitute like Stevia or monk fruit.
- Chocolate Variations: Add white chocolate chips instead of dark chocolate for a different flavor combination, or stir in some nut butter (like peanut butter or almond butter) for richness.
- Add-ins: You can get creative with the mix-ins. Try adding chopped nuts (like almonds or hazelnuts) or a sprinkle of cinnamon for extra flavor.
